Abstract
The invention discloses a kind of device for driving the automatic divide-shut brake of breaker,Including housing,Circuit board is further included,Transmission shaft,Dropout interlocking bar,Motor and transmission mechanism,Transmission mechanism includes offset gear and travelling gear,Travelling gear links with transmission shaft,The output shaft of offset gear and motor links,Offset gear includes gear wheel and sector gear,Sector gear is arranged on gear wheel side,Sector gear can be engaged with travelling gear,Limiting slot is provided with housing,Dropout interlocking bar includes abutting portion and swing arm,Swing arm is threaded through on limiting slot,Sector gear turns to contradict with abutting portion drives dropout interlocking bar to rotate when coordinating,Press part is linkedly set with offset gear,Can close a floodgate interrupt switch and separating brake interrupt switch are provided with circuit board,Press part can be inconsistent with the contact of combined floodgate interrupt switch and the contact of separating brake interrupt switch respectively.The shortcomings of the prior art is overcome using the above scheme, can control the automatic divide-shut brake of external breaker.
Description
Technical field
The present invention relates to field of circuit breakers, especially a kind of device for driving the automatic divide-shut brake of breaker.

General breaker includes housing, buckle releaser, arc-control device, static contact, moving contact, handle mechanism and terminals
Son, handle mechanism include handle, tripping, moving contact rack, lock, latch spring and tension spring, and moving contact is fixed at dynamic touch
On head bracket, long through-hole is provided with moving contact rack, axis pin is provided with long through-hole, the both ends of the axis pin are arranged on housing
On, tension spring one end is connected on moving contact rack, and is located at the top of long through-hole with the tie point of moving contact rack, tension spring it is another
One end is fixedly connected on housing, and tripping is hingedly arranged on the upper end of moving contact rack, is connected between tripping and handle by first
Bar connects, and lock middle part is movably set on axis pin by the through hole of setting, and lock top, which is extended with to contradict with tripping, to be coordinated
The conflict foot that tripping rotates is limited, lock lower section, which is equipped with, promotes foot, wherein promote the push rod of foot and buckle releaser to be correspondingly arranged, push rod
It can promote and promote foot to rotate so as to fulfill lock rotation, lock, which rotates, unlocks tripping and the conflict contradicted between foot, at this moment moves
Breaker open operation can be achieved in contact supporting under the action of tension spring, and latch spring gives the driving that lock keeps contradicting with tripping
Power, and promotion foot is rotated to the push rod side of buckle releaser, in order to enable breaker automatic closing or separating brake, it is necessary to pass through control
Divide-shut brake can be achieved in the rotation of handle processed and the rotation of lock, the rotation of handle, and the conflict that lock departs from tripping can be achieved
Automatic brake separating.

By using such scheme, motor and circuit board electrical connection, motor can drive offset gear to rotate, on offset gear
Sector gear fix or be integrally disposed upon the side of gear wheel, the gear wheel of offset gear will not be meshed with travelling gear,
When circuit is received by separating brake to reclosing command, motor driving offset gear rotates, and it is neutral gear that offset gear, which has 4/5ths circles,
The sector gear of offset gear is engaged with travelling gear, and travelling gear just starts to rotate, so that drive transmission shaft to rotate, transmission shaft
One end stretch out housing and couple with the handle of external breaker, so as to drive the progress automatic closing operation of external breaker, completion
The sector gear of offset gear departs from travelling gear after combined floodgate, and is rotated further, until press part is encountered and is fully pressed to close a floodgate
The contact of interrupt switch, combined floodgate interrupt switch output combined floodgate finish signal to circuit board, and circuit board provides the letter that stops operating at this time
Number, drive motor stops operating, and whole making process is completed at this time, belongs to "on" position;When circuit is received by closing a floodgate to separating brake
During instruction, motor driving offset gear rotates, and offset gear turns to the abutting portion of sector gear and dropout interlocking bar thereon
Inconsistent, the swing arm of dropout interlocking bar stretches out limiting slot and links with the lock of external breaker, and swing arm can only be at certain angle
Rotated in the range of degree, in original state, swing arm is contradicted in the lower wall of limiting slot, and the sector gear of offset gear, which drives, to be taken off
Detain interlocking bar to rotate, swing arm is rotated up along limiting slot and can stir the lock of external breaker makes external breaker quickly divide
Lock, press part are encountered and are fully pressed to the contact of separating brake interrupt switch, and separating brake interrupt switch output separating brake finishes signal to circuit
Plate, circuit board provide the signal that stops operating, and drive motor stops operating, and is now under gate-dividing state, and offset gear is in certainly
Lock status, swing arm contradict on the upper side wall of limiting slot all the time, it is impossible to reset the lock of external breaker, the lock of breaker
Do not contradicted with tripping, it is impossible to carry out closing by hand operation, which can automatically control external breaker according to the instruction of reception
Automatic divide-shut brake, and under separating brake command status, it is impossible to close a floodgate manually, it is safer;After the completion of reclosing command, it is in
During combined floodgate completion status, divide-shut brake can be carried out manually.

The present invention has following technique effect:
1st, when automatic switching off/on device is arranged on automatic transmission and control signal provides be by separating brake to switching signal when, drive horse
The offset gear 61 driven in transmission mechanism is rotated forward up to 5, is realized so as to drive transmission shaft 3 to rotate and drive circuit breaker handle to rotate
Breaker automatic closing, belongs to remote control "on" position at this time, and breaker can be by manually arbitrarily being divided/being closed
Lock;
2nd, when automatic switching off/on device is arranged on automatic transmission and what control signal provided is by closing a floodgate to sub-gate signal, driving horse
Rotated forward up to 5 by driving the offset gear 61 in transmission mechanism to drive dropout interlocking bar 4, dropout interlocking bar 4 is stirred in breaker
Lock realize breaker automatic brake separating, belong to remote control gate-dividing state at this time, external tripping device for circuit breaker is locked in de-
Buckle-like state, manually closes not brake application;
3rd, when automatic close/open machine be arranged on that manual and control signal provides be by closing a floodgate to sub-gate signal when, it is and automatic
Shelves provide that sub-gate signal principle is consistent, i.e., drive motor 5 is rotated forward by driving the offset gear 61 in transmission mechanism to drive dropout
Interlocking bar 4, the lock that dropout interlocking bar 4 is stirred in breaker realize breaker automatic brake separating, belong to remote control separating brake at this time
State, external tripping device for circuit breaker are locked in trip status, manually close not brake application;
4th, when automatic close/open machine be arranged on that manual and control signal provides be by separating brake to switching signal when, drive horse
Up to 5 reversions, while offset gear 61 is driven to invert, sector gear 612 departs from the abutting portion 41 of dropout interlocking bar 4, breaking at this time
Device can be with manual divide-shut brake.But as long as automatic close/open machine is arranged on manual, control terminal can only control automatic brake separating, no
Automatic closing can be controlled;
5th, can realize remote signal control automatic closing and separating brake, and can be fed back by distinct feed-back signal breaker closing with
Gate-dividing state;It can judge that breaker is fault trip, people's work point by the signal that remote control terminal and distinct feed-back end are fed back
Lock, the maintenance of artificial separating brake or arrearage tripping etc..When tripping or malfunction are broken down in certain unattended region, without
The scene of sending someone carries out manual closing operation, can carry out automatic closing by remote control operation;When certain unattended region needs
Remote control automatic brake separating can be passed through during power-off;When certain unattended region needs to recover electricity consumption, pass through remote control
Automatic closing;, can be with remote control separating brake when subscriber arrearage;After user continues to pay dues, it can be closed a floodgate with remote control;
6th, when subscribers' line needs maintenance, manual gear can be arranged on, turns off remote control automatic closing semiotic function, but
Remote control automatic brake separating signal cannot be turned off, the ability of remote control automatic closing is lost, automatic brake separating can only be controlled, avoided
Automatic closing causes service personnel during maintenance to be electrically shocked;As long as i.e. automatic close/open machine is arranged on manual, control terminal is only
Automatic brake separating can be controlled, it is impossible to control automatic closing;
7th, manual or automatic transmission no matter is arranged on, as long as remote control signal is sub-gate signal, breaker remote control point
Belong to separating brake locking state after lock, it is impossible to by manually closing a floodgate.
